If Looks Could Kill

One of the hardest part of wearing hijab is when you don't know what to wear but you surely know what not to wear. In my personal opinion, there are some reason why I don't wear any particular materials. First it has to be light on my head and nothing under my scarf. I dont use anything that convert me into a “mommy looking lady”. From my experience, wearing hijab somehow add my age and some kilos as well. It’s a feeling that I have to get used to it.

Wearing hijab means my life wont be the same. I realize I was actually having a new life couple years later, which wasn't what I had originally hoped, both good and bad. After enthusiasm on the new look and enjoyment of having what seems like a good idea, I then have to face up to my inability of knowing what hijab actualy is. Be ready to accept changes.

In the end, I just have to be comfortable with anything I wear. Knowing myself and my face is halfway to know what kind of hijab perfectly shape my face.
